Мониторинг состояний

Материал из Integra-S Wiki
Версия от 15:48, 27 сентября 2018; Mikheeva (обсуждение | вклад) (Пользовательский элемент)
Перейти к: навигация, поиск

Мониторинг состояний — это веб компонент "Интегра Планета Земля", отображающий комплексную информацию о серверах, охранных, пожарных, видео системах и т.д.

Для запуска компонента необходимо выбрать пункт меню: Дополнительно => Мониторинг состояний.

Complex 1.png

Авторизация

Ot2.png
  1. Адрес сервера авторизации (Serenity)
  2. Логин
  3. Пароль
  4. Адрес сервера приложений (Firefly)
  5. Кнопка входа

Для запуска приложения необходимо прописать Ip адрес Serenity, ввести логин и пароль пользователя, нажать «Вход». Далее появится поле для ввода ip адреса сервера приложения, вводим адрес и нажимаем вход.

Основное окно

C monit 2.png
  1. Окно компонента
  2. Список типов для мониторинга

Меню настроек

Для вызова или закрытия меню необходимо нажать "Ctrl+Q". Настройки сохраняются после закрытия меню.

Вкладки настроек

В меню настроек есть следующие вкладки:

StateMonitor 8.PNG
  1. Настройка типов
  2. Другие настройки

Настройка типов

Вкладка "Настройка типов" позволяет настроить элементы для их отображения и мониторинга.

StateMonitor 9.PNG
  1. Область элементов - предназначена для включения и отключения элементов, необходимых для отображения и мониторинга
  2. область подключений - предназначена для создания, настройки и удаления подключения
  3. Область серверов - предназначена для выбора серверов, с которых будут запрашиваться данные о состоянии элементов
  4. Область элементов сервера - предназначена для выбора элементов сервера, необходимых для мониторинга
Элементы

Область, предназначенная для включения и отключения элементов, необходимых для отображения и мониторинга. Выключенные элементы отображаются красным цветом, включенные - зеленым.

StateMonitor 10.PNG
  1. Кнопка удаления пользовательского элемента
  2. Область поиска необходимых элементов
  3. Фильтрация списка элементов. Крайнее левое положение - отображение выключенных элементов, крайнее правое - отображение включенных элементов, среднее - отображение всех элементов
  4. Кнопка добавления пользовательского элемента
  5. Список пользовательских элементов для мониторинга
  6. Список элементов для мониторинга

Для включения/выключения элемента необходимо нажать ПКМ по его наименованию.

Пользовательский элемент

Для добавления пользовательского элемента необходимо нажать на кнопку "Добавить", после чего будет отображена область добавления элемента.

StateMonitor 19.PNG
  1. Поле для ввода названия пользовательского элемента
  2. Кнопка "Загрузить изображение"
  3. Кнопка "Применить"
  4. Кнопка "Отменить"
  5. Список элементов для добавления в пользовательский элемент

Для добавления элемента в пользовательский элемент необходимо нажать по его названию в списке, после чего он окрасится в зеленый цвет.

Для загрузки изображения, необходимо нажать на кнопку "Загрузить изображение". После этого откроется окно для выбора файла.

Shem 9.PNG

Название файла появится в области редактирования элемента.

Shem 10.PNG

Далее необходимо нажать на кнопку "Применить". После закрытия настроек можно увидеть загруженное изображение.

Shem 11.PNG

Для редактирования пользовательского элемента необходимо два раза кликнуть по его наименованию. Для просмотра элементов, включенных в пользовательский элемент, нужно произвести фильтрацию списка по включенным объектам.

StateMonitor 20.PNG
Подключения
StateMonitor 11.PNG
  1. Поле ввода нового подключения, для добавления необходимо нажать на клавишу "Enter"
  2. Удаление подключения
  3. Поле созданных подключений. Для изменения подключения необходимо 2 раза нажать ПКМ
Сервера
StateMonitor 12.PNG
  1. Добавление сервера для участия в мониторинге
  2. Добавление всех серверов
  3. Убрать добавление всех серверов
  4. Наименование сервера

По нажатию на наименование сервера открываются присутствующие в нем элементы, если они выбраны в области элементов.

Элементы сервера
StateMonitor 13.PNG
  1. Добавление элемента для участия в мониторинге
  2. Добавление всех элементов для участия в мониторинге
  3. Убрать добавление все элементов
  4. Наименование элемента сервера

Другие настройки

Данная вкладка предназначена для установки времени обновления состояний объектов, выбора типа сортировки серверов в виджете состояний категории и регулировки скрытия настроек при обновлении. Если установить скрытие настроек, то через установленное время обновления на заданное количество времени будет скрываться вкладка с настройками.

StateMonitor 14.PNG

Примечание: Время скрытия настроек должно быть меньше времени обновления. Время задается в секундах.

При выборе стандартной сортировки сервера сортируются следующим образом:

  1. По количеству тревожных элементов выбранной категории на сервере
  2. Затем по количеству неисправных элементов (если нет тревожных)
  3. Далее сервера без тревожных и неисправных сортируются по неизвестным элементам
  4. Затем по количеству исправных элементов

В случае равного количества сервера сортируются по алфавиту.

StateMonitor 15.PNG

При выборе процентной сортировки элементы сортируются в таком же порядке, что и при стандартной, но не по количеству элементов, а по отношению количества данного состояния на общее число элементов.

StateMonitor 16.PNG

При выборе сортировки по алфавиту сервера сортируются по их наименованию.

StateMonitor 17.PNG

Виджет состояния категории

C monit 4.png
  1. Иконка категории
  2. Количество датчиков в категории
  3. Индикация состояния датчиков в категории
  4. Индикация состояния категории

Расширенное меню

Для вызова расширенного меню необходимо нажать на виджет состояния категории.

C monit 5.png
  1. Название объекта
  2. Общее количество элементов выбранной категории
  3. Количество элементов в исправном состоянии
  4. Количество элементов в состоянии тревоги
  5. Количество элементов в неисправном состоянии
  6. Количество элементов в неизвестном состоянии
  7. Поле для поиска объектов в списке
  8. Количество элементов на объекте
  9. Индикация состояния элементов на объекте

По нажатию на ПКМ по полосе индикации отображается список возможных состояний на объекте, текущие состояния выделены жирным шрифтом. По каждому из состояний можно посмотреть отчет.

StateMonitor 7.PNG

Для раскрытия подробной информации об элементе необходимо нажать на название объекта, например, «Офис Интегра-С». По нажатию на одно из состояний элементов на объекте отображается список элементов выбранного состояния.

C monit 6.png
  1. Название элемента
  2. Поле поиска по элементам
  3. Отчет по элементу

В случае если страница открыта в клиенте "Интегра Планета 4Д", то по нажатию ЛКМ на элемент осуществляется переход к нему на плане.

При нажатии на ПКМ по элементу появляется подробная информация о его состоянии. Если состояние элемента, отличное от исправного, то описывается причина отображения данного состояния.

StateMonitor 6.PNG

Добавление новой категории для мониторинга

Для того чтобы добавить новую категорию для мониторинга, необходимо открыть файл config.js, который находится в папке с установленным клиентом: IntegraPlanetEarthX.X.X\www\ComplexState\js\config.js и в строке «types» написать английское (исходное) название необходимой для добавления категории, например «FireSecurityCategory». Если необходимо задать конкретную последовательность отображения категорий для мониторинга в виджите, то в строке «types» необходимо указать их в нужном порядке. Таким же образом происходит добавление любых типов например, «Server», «Computer» и т.д.

C monit 7.png